Hey Brendan,

We used Google Sheets for about 6 years (excel prior) to manage our flips. We are a small size team, I’d say. We were doing about 4-5 projects at a time. The issue we were running into was formulas getting mixed up, cells being deleted, rows being added and then some cells being omitted from calculations - so I rebuilt our entire system. We use QBO for accounting and have a google sheet that automatically feeds any transactions for that property over, but we have a custom built software that handles all of the calculations now. Super helpful. 

Just be cautious if you go the spreadsheet route and double check all formulas and calculations.
